All posts

Using Nmap to Audit and Control OAuth Scopes for Tighter Security

A single leaked OAuth token can tear through your infrastructure faster than an open port on a forgotten server. Nmap is known for mapping networks, but paired with OAuth scopes management, it becomes something far more precise: a way to surface, audit, and control exactly what your services and integrations can do. The stakes are higher than just knowing which ports are open. Misconfigured or over-permissive OAuth scopes are silent invitations to abuse. OAuth scopes define the boundaries of a

Free White Paper

OAuth 2.0 + K8s Audit Logging: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

A single leaked OAuth token can tear through your infrastructure faster than an open port on a forgotten server.

Nmap is known for mapping networks, but paired with OAuth scopes management, it becomes something far more precise: a way to surface, audit, and control exactly what your services and integrations can do. The stakes are higher than just knowing which ports are open. Misconfigured or over-permissive OAuth scopes are silent invitations to abuse.

OAuth scopes define the boundaries of access. They control whether an integration can just read basic data or push destructive changes. Without routine inventory and enforcement, scopes sprawl. Unused permissions linger. Risk multiplies. In complex environments, the number of integrations and tokens grows until no one can state, with confidence, what has access to what.

Using Nmap for OAuth scopes management means combining active network scanning with detailed permission mapping. While Nmap discovers exposed endpoints and services, a disciplined OAuth scope audit layers in a permissions map for every token in use. This process delivers two main outcomes: reduce attack surface and gain operational clarity.

The workflow is straightforward:

Continue reading? Get the full guide.

OAuth 2.0 + K8s Audit Logging: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.
  • Map endpoints with Nmap to reveal every reachable service.
  • Enumerate every OAuth token tied to those services.
  • Compare active scopes against actual operational requirements.
  • Revoke or rotate tokens with unused or high-risk scopes.
  • Monitor continuously — treat scopes like ports, always subject to change.

Security gains compound fast. Teams shrink their permission surface area. Attackers find fewer ways in. Operational reviews become faster because scope maps replace endless guesswork.

Nmap OAuth scopes management is not just a one-off security audit. It’s a continuous discipline. The threats you block today evolve tomorrow. The integrations you trust today may pivot, expand, or introduce APIs that quietly increase their scope requirements. Without monitoring, growth in scope is invisible until impact hits.

Automating this process removes manual drag. With the right platform, you can plug in your OAuth tokens, map scopes instantly, and tie them directly to discovered endpoints. You end up with a live, always-accurate permissions map, without burning weeks of engineer time.

You can see it work in minutes. Go to hoop.dev and watch your scope inventory turn from unknown risk into a clear, searchable list linked to your network map. The result is speed, control, and the kind of visibility every system needs but few achieve.

Do you want me to also generate optimized subheadings and meta description for this post so it can rank even higher?

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ts